pleasant comfort
Kirpianuscus24 February 2024
Not an original theme but one proposing real thrills. Especially for the end. For comfort of its clients, a companz produces szntetic pleasure beings. Robots, from three versions of a young lady to a man, , sznthetic children and venerable man.

All becomes secure, simple and , except protests, pure routine. But... The great virtue of film remains the final , reminding old and serious fears about robots.

Sure, crumbs of conspiracz theories , some dark humor and a posibilitz not so eccentric. And the ironic perspective about easy life defining us in so much measure.

In short, portrait of pleasant life, far by socialisation obligations, in full comfort. And its presumed high price.
